(+)
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)

миниатюрный аудио-видеорекордер mAVR

Отправлено Max_Fly 19 мая 2004 г. 16:40
В ответ на: Ответ: Основы для новичков... :-) отправлено Bill 19 мая 2004 г. 16:22

порылся - не могу быстро найти ссылку. Я начну - а остальные продолжат или поправят.
сетевые адаптеры бывают проводные и беспроводные
беспроводные пока в сторону - проводные работают по разным проводам (про витой паре - тонкому или толстому коаксилу по телефонным проводам и т.п.) По этой сетевые адаптеры делят на 2 половинки - phy - то что зависит от среды распространения сигналов и mac - то что не зависит от среды распространения сигналов.
далее предположим что имеем дело с ehernet. пакет (совокупность информации и служебных полей) оформляется спереди заголовком который гласит что внутри, а сам заголовок предваряется синхропосылкой. phy синхронизирует Pll по этой посылке и считается что на протяжении пакета (а максимальная длинна 1495 байт - ...тут могу промахнуться...) не рассинхронизируется.phy - отвечает ещё за обнаружение колизии (если несколько адаптеров одновременно накидываются на собрата) и автопереговоры - чтобы договориться о работе на максимальной скорости которую поддерживают обе стороны взаимодействия. mac - имеет буфера у себя + умеет обрабатывать информацию приходящую от phy (например самостоятельно перепослать пакет из буфера если клиент ответил что ему помешала коллизия принять инфу). Каждый сетевой адаптер имеет свой личный идентификационный номер. в сети каждому сетевому адаптеру присваивается сетевой адрес. Если машина только что рождившись хочет что либо передать\получить - она должна в первую очередь - узнать какой идентификационный номер имеет адаптер той машины с которой мы хотели бы связаться. За это отвечает протокол arp. так например комутатор всегда знает какая машина в какой порт включена - потому непосредственно после автопереговоров - свич будет генерировать arp пакеты чтобы переслать информацию.

Составить ответ  |||  Конференция  |||  Архив

Ответы



Перейти к списку ответов  |||  Конференция  |||  Архив  |||  Главная страница  |||  Содержание  |||  Без кадра

E-mail: info@telesys.ru